一类捕食-食饵模型正平衡解的存在性

         

摘要

The positive equilibrium solution exists of a Holling-IV type predator-prey model with homogeneous Dirichlet boundary condition is concerned in this paper. First,the model is equivalent to an elliptic boundary problem to make a priori estimate of positive solutions. Then,by using the degree theory, calculating the index of the fixed point of the compact map in cone and combining with the operator spectrum analysis,some sufficient conditions for the existence of positive equilibrium solutions are obtained. The result shows that the existence of the positive solution is closely related to the eigenvalues of differential operators derived from the model.%研究了一类在齐次Dirichlet边界条件下的Holling-Ⅳ型捕食-食饵模型正平衡解的存在性.首先,将该模型等价为椭圆边值问题,对正解做出先验估计.然后,利用度理论和锥映射的不动点计算方法,再结合算予谱分析,得出该模型存在正平衡解的充分条件.结果表明,该模型正平衡解的存在性与模型的导算子的特征值密切相关.
